Minister for Local Government Balaam Barugahara has clarified that the DNA tests carried out on the alleged children of late music legend Paul Kafeero were funded using his personal money.

Balaam dismissed claims that government resources were used in the exercise, insisting it was a personal decision driven by the friendship he shared with the late Kadongo Kamu icon.

“I used personal funds to carry out the recently released DNA tests as a friend to the late. The government has no such a budget to do so,” Balaam explained.

Support Beyond DNA Results

The minister also revealed that he plans to support the 21 children who were excluded after the DNA results.

According to Balaam, he is working with other well-wishers to help them acquire land and settle properly, despite the fact that they were found not to be biologically linked to Kafeero.

Mixed Reactions

The revelation has sparked mixed reactions, with some praising Balaam for his personal intervention and compassion, while others continue debating the wider implications of the DNA process.

Still, many have welcomed his pledge to support the affected children, saying it shows concern beyond the controversy.
